Warning Signs You Need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ration

Don’t wait until it’s too late, if you notice any of these warning signs call us immediately to schedule a restoration appointment: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

When you notice a musty smell in your laundry room that won’t go away, it’s a sign of moisture. If left unchecked, this moisture can lead to mold growth, which can be hazardous to your health. Our team will inspect your laundry room and find out the source of the moisture.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

When your flooring becomes warped or buckled, it’s a sign that the water damage has spread. Our team will inspect your flooring and replace any damaged areas to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ceiling

When you notice water stains on your walls and ceiling, it’s a sign of water damage. Our team will inspect your walls and ceiling and repair any damaged areas to prevent further damage.

Leaks Under Appliances

When you notice leaks under your appliances, it’s a sign of water damage. Our team will inspect your appliances and repair any damaged areas to prevent further damage.

Water Damage Behind Walls

When you notice water damage behind your walls, it’s a sign that the water has spread further than you think. Our team will inspect your walls and repair any damaged areas to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int and Wallpaper

When you notice peeling paint and wallpaper, it’s a sign of moisture. Our team will inspect your walls and repair any damaged areas to prevent further damage.

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ration Cost in Atoka, TN

The cost of laundry room water damage restoration can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Atoka, TN.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Inspection and repair of hidden damage $1,500 – $6,000 Severity of damage, complexity of repair
Replacement of damaged flooring and walls $2,000 – $8,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ring or wall
Repair of appliances and plumbing $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, type of appliance or plumbing
